List of usage examples for com.intellij.openapi.wm ToolWindow setAutoHide
void setAutoHide(boolean value);
From source file:com.github.cssxfire.IncomingChangesComponent.java
License:Apache License
public void projectOpened() { if (!CssXFireConnector.getInstance().isInitialized()) { return;/* w w w .j av a2s . c om*/ } final ToolWindow toolWindow = ToolWindowManager.getInstance(project).registerToolWindow(TOOLWINDOW_ID, true, ToolWindowAnchor.BOTTOM); final ContentFactory contentFactory = toolWindow.getContentManager().getFactory(); final Content content = contentFactory.createContent(cssToolWindow, "Incoming changes", true); Disposer.register(content, cssToolWindow); Disposer.register(project, content); content.setCloseable(false); toolWindow.getContentManager().addContent(content); toolWindow.setAutoHide(false); toolWindow.setAvailable(true, null); CssXFireConnector.getInstance().addProjectComponent(this); PsiManager.getInstance(project).addPsiTreeChangeListener(myListener); }
From source file:com.googlecode.cssxfire.IncomingChangesComponent.java
License:Apache License
public void projectOpened() { if (!CssXFireConnector.getInstance().isInitialized()) { return;//from ww w.j a v a 2 s . co m } final ToolWindow toolWindow = ToolWindowManager.getInstance(project).registerToolWindow(TOOLWINDOW_ID, true, ToolWindowAnchor.BOTTOM); final ContentFactory contentFactory = toolWindow.getContentManager().getFactory(); final Content content = contentFactory.createContent(cssToolWindow, "Incoming changes", true); toolWindow.getContentManager().addContent(content); toolWindow.setAutoHide(false); toolWindow.setAvailable(true, null); CssXFireConnector.getInstance().addProjectComponent(this); PsiManager.getInstance(project).addPsiTreeChangeListener(myListener); }
From source file:com.intellij.ide.actions.TogglePinnedModeAction.java
License:Apache License
@Override protected void setSelected(ToolWindow window, boolean state) { window.setAutoHide(!state); }